Lillian and Michael

69, Retired

72, Retired

ABOUT US:
Having been the owners of animals, two rescue dogs at different times and a cat (we lost our last dog 18 months ago). We now look after neighbours/friends pets, from time to time; including our friend's dog and cat in Sydney, when we travel within Australia,

While we remain physically active and eager to explore, we miss the companionship of animals. By registering on this site, we hope to reconnect with pets we dearly miss, meet new people, and visit new places.

BACKGROUND AND EXPERIENCE
Lillian
 Early Life: Grew up on a working farm, gaining extensive experience with various animals including
sheep, cattle, milking cows, pigs, horses, chickens, and working farm dogs. This upbringing instilled a deep understanding of animal welfare.
 1980s: Worked on two country estates in the UK, responsible for animal care and domestic duties. Lived on-site, respecting privacy and property.
 1990s: Employed in the pharmaceutical sector, focusing on animal care products marketed through veterinary channels.

Historical Voluntary Work:
 Volunteered at an SPCA charity shop and walked SPCA pound dogs for three years (Society for the
Prevention of Cruelty to Animals).
 Served as an operational crew member for Bay of Islands Coastguard, Search and Rescue, saving lives at sea for five years.
Approved NZ Police check during Coastguard operational work.

Michael
 1970s: Obtained an agricultural qualification from the UK with a certificate in animal husbandry.
 1980s: Worked as a sales representative for an Animal Feed & Seed firm in the UK.
 1990s: Employed by an Animal Health Pharmaceutical company in the UK, specializing in anthelmintics.

Historical Voluntary Work:
 Served as a Coastguard Air Patrol Safety officer for three years.
 Participated in wood chopping activities to raise money for the Fred Hollows Foundation by cutting and delivering firewood.

OUR PHILOSOPHY
Having adopted a cat and two rescue dogs, we understand the dedication required to provide a stable and
loving environment, especially for animals needing medical attention, like our West Highland White Terriers.
There is nothing more rewarding than adopting an abused animal, witnessing it grow in confidence, watching it prosper. They truly become an integral part of the family.
